Abstract : Several modifications are introduced to the Elliptic Blending Differential Flux Model proposed by Shin et al. (2008). The suggested formulation is applicable to the three flow regimes; forced, mixed and natural convection. Very encouraging results are obtained for two channel flows in forced and mixed convection and for a cavity flow in the natural convection regime.
